Bill Lilly is the latest Comfort Heating & Air Salute to Service honoree.

Bill, who has been a nurse since 1994, currently works as a clinic nurse with Comcare in Salina. He also has worked as a geriatric nurse.

His nominator wrote, "Bill has spent his career caring for others and giving of himself to go the extra mile to make his patients feel better."

Comfort Heating & Air and Mokas Coffee are back this fall with their "Salute to Service" program, a weekly contest on Salina Post to honor a local police officers, military members, medical professionals, or first responders. Each week, a winner will be selected and will receive a $50 gift card to Mokas Coffee in Salina.

All the weekly winners will be entered in a random drawing to be held on Dec. 20 to win a Salina Staycation with hotel, a local gift cards for shopping and food. Additionally, Comfort Heating & Air will also donate $500 to the charity or service organization of the grand prize winner’s choice.
